Top Fidget Toys Games Performance in Qatar Q3 2025

In the third quarter of 2025, the performance of top fidget toys games in Qatar presented varied trends across different metrics. Data sourced from Sensor Tower highlights key insights into these applications.

Slime it: Slime Game Simulator by Slime4Fun showed a stable revenue pattern, peaking at approximately $32 in the week of September 8. However, its weekly downloads and active users remained negligible throughout the quarter.

Rolling ASMR from Lumos Games exper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, reaching its highest at $30 in late July. Active users remained steady, maintaining around 4 users weekly.

Pop it Game - Fidget Toys 3D by Sound Jedi Ltd. witnessed a significant increase in revenue toward the end of August, with a notable peak of $38 in early September. Its downloads were minimal, while active users saw a slight engagement mid-quarter.

Automatoys from Idle Friday saw varied revenue, culminating in a peak of $35 at the end of September. Downloads peaked at 49 in late July, while active users showed a gradual decline from 128 in mid-July to 73 by the end of September.

Lastly, Antistress - Relaxing games by Moreno Maio exhibited consistent download numbers, with a peak of 535 in early July. Revenue began to rise in September, reaching $31 in the second week, while active users decreased slightly from 1.8K to 1.5K over the quarter.
